Job Summary

Primary responsibility for performing one-person repair and piping jobs.  May be required to perform two-person fitter jobs with a Helper. One-person jobs will never exceed 2” diameter nipples and /or an AL630 meter set. May be assigned service work normally performed by a Service Technician “A”.

Key Responsibilities

  • Performs or assists as necessary in installing, changing, relocating, and removing meters, repairing and removing piping meter connections and service regulators.
  • When required, performs the duties of a Service Technician “A on the day shift.
  • Responsible for oiling meters upon installation or replacement, and rotating meter index as required.

Required Qualifications

  • Must have qualified as Service Technician “A”.
  • Must maintain an acceptable personal appearance and acceptable job knowledge.
  • Must display knowledge of safety procedures and rules of the Company.
  • Must have the ability to make written, legible and accurate reports of all services performed on the customer’s premises.
  • This position is a DOT Safety Sensitive position which requires applicant to comply with all drug and alcohol regulations. Respiratory Fit Test may be required.
  • Must possess current OQ qualifications for Fitter A
